Overview
A familiar institutional-onchain storyline is advancing: JPMorgan is extending its USD-denominated deposit token (JPM Coin) beyond prior deployments, this time issuing it natively on the privacy-focused Canton Network. Coverage frames the move as part of a broader multi-chain approach and a push toward real-time settlement on privacy-enabled infrastructure, with implementation expected to roll out in phases across 2026.

Why now
- Multiple outlets reported the Canton issuance plan within the same 24h window
- Coverage frames Canton as the next step after JPM Coin’s earlier Base extension
- Implementation timing is being set with a phased rollout through 2026
Why it matters
- Signals continued bank experimentation with regulated digital cash on blockchain rails
- Highlights privacy-enabled infrastructure as a target for institutional settlement use cases
- Reinforces multi-chain deployment patterns for tokenized bank liabilities
